Your symptoms are likely related to cold-induced chilblains (Pernio) or poor peripheral circulation caused by extreme cold exposure. In Ayurveda, this condition is commonly associated with aggravated Vata and Kapha dosha, leading to poor blood circulation, numbness, pain, and skin inflammation during winter. Advice: Keep feet continuously warm and dry. Avoid direct exposure to snow, cold floors, and tight shoes. Use insulated woolen socks and soft, warm footwear. Daily gentle massage with warm Mahanarayan oil or sesame oil can help improve circulation.
